Tail Eating
I once had my horse in a pasture with several horses and some cows with
calves. Never could figure out which one was eating his tail. So, since I
couldn't prevent it, I protected his tail. I braided it and put a sock on
the losse section. I used one of those neoprene wraps on the dock. I
patched the chew holes that appeared in the wrap with duct tape. The
neoprene wrap is loose enough that there is no damage to the tail and it
worked perfectly.
